Output 3ab0759cc97b1f14602191317e96421e1f9e14c1a2453929a9f29d05db77ffe1:0

value
2677495
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3979a044825edc6706313fd848fbdb48d7877eb6 OP_EQUALVERIFY OP_CHECKSIG
address
16EuDfHdodt7cMbRPWcoSBNTVX1x7yckNr
transaction
3ab0759cc97b1f14602191317e96421e1f9e14c1a2453929a9f29d05db77ffe1
spent
true